Output 5f95736bc2523c17e83ac0a2fdd52a9bea25d6c1f370ce8e5335c17707e030ea:0

value
292705
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73da4f7f80080bcc70977d2e76aebd75c48dec25 OP_EQUAL
address
3CFbA5y3CqJefNyD1UVPAjbF1H3RZ3uEJ3
transaction
5f95736bc2523c17e83ac0a2fdd52a9bea25d6c1f370ce8e5335c17707e030ea
spent
true